Aluminum tubing and framing extrusions are fundamental parts in building and construction and manufacturing markets. These extrusions are produced via a procedure where light weight aluminum billets are heated and forced with a shaped die to develop the desired cross-sectional profile. The result is lightweight yet strong parts that are made use of for everything from architectural supports in structures to framework for commercial equipment.

One of the crucial advantages of aluminum tubes and framing extrusions is their flexibility. In building, aluminum tubing is commonly used in frameworks for home windows, doors, curtain walls, and roof covering trusses due to its lightweight nature and ability to hold up against severe climate conditions.

In production, aluminum framing extrusions act as the backbone for setting up makers, conveyor systems, and other devices. The capacity to quickly link and assemble these extrusions utilizing bolts and devices such as T-slot nuts and brackets boosts their usability and adaptability in commercial setups. This modularity allows for quick modifications and growths as production needs adjustment, promoting efficiency and cost-effectiveness in manufacturing operations.

T-Slot Aluminum Systems

T-slot aluminum systems, additionally referred to as modular light weight aluminum framing systems or light weight aluminum extrusion systems, are functional services for creating equipment structures, workstations, units, and other structures. These systems feature light weight aluminum accounts with T-shaped slots on several sides, permitting very easy setting up and reconfiguration making use of fasteners and aluminum waterproof flooring devices such as T-slot nuts, screws, and brackets.

One of the primary benefits of T-slot light weight aluminum systems is their modularity and versatility in design. Users can quickly link and set up light weight aluminum profiles to produce custom-made configurations that satisfy certain dimension, form, and performance demands. This adaptability makes T-slot systems suitable for a large range of applications in production, automation, robotics, and industrial machinery.

T-slot aluminum profiles are readily available in different sizes, forms, and alloy structures to accommodate various load capacities and architectural demands. Common accounts include basic T-slot accounts with several ports for flexible assembly, heavy-duty accounts for durable applications, and specialized profiles with distinct functions such as closed faces or incorporated electrical wiring networks for improved capability.
